Now, however, a tract of was purchased at Hart's Mill on the river's edge in the Pass, near what is today the UTEP.
By 1890, Hart's Mill had outlived its usefulness, and Congress appropriated $ 150, 000 for construction of a military installation on the mesa approximately east of El Paso's 1890 city limits.

The New Hart's Rules are based the " Hart's Rules for Compositors and Readers " published by Oxford University Press in 1893.
Hart's Rules originated as a compilation of rules and standards by Horace Hart over almost three decades during his employment at other printing establishments, but they were first printed as a single broadsheet page for in-house use by the OUP in 1893 while Hart was Controller of the University Press.
